GI.Rsvg.Structs.DimensionData
Description
Dimensions of an SVG image from handleGetDimensions, or an
individual element from handleGetDimensionsSub. Please see
the deprecation documentation for those functions.

newZeroDimensionData :: MonadIO m => m DimensionData Source #
Construct a DimensionData struct initialized to zero.
Methods
Properties
em
SVG's original width, unmodified by RsvgSizeFunc
getDimensionDataEm :: MonadIO m => DimensionData -> m Double Source #
Get the value of the “em” field.
When overloading is enabled, this is equivalent to
get dimensionData #em
setDimensionDataEm :: MonadIO m => DimensionData -> Double -> m () Source #
Set the value of the “em” field.
When overloading is enabled, this is equivalent to
setdimensionData [ #em:=value ]
ex
SVG's original height, unmodified by RsvgSizeFunc
getDimensionDataEx :: MonadIO m => DimensionData -> m Double Source #
Get the value of the “ex” field.
When overloading is enabled, this is equivalent to
get dimensionData #ex
setDimensionDataEx :: MonadIO m => DimensionData -> Double -> m () Source #
Set the value of the “ex” field.
When overloading is enabled, this is equivalent to
setdimensionData [ #ex:=value ]
height
SVG's height, in pixels
getDimensionDataHeight :: MonadIO m => DimensionData -> m Int32 Source #
Get the value of the “height” field.
When overloading is enabled, this is equivalent to
get dimensionData #height
setDimensionDataHeight :: MonadIO m => DimensionData -> Int32 -> m () Source #
Set the value of the “height” field.
When overloading is enabled, this is equivalent to
setdimensionData [ #height:=value ]
width
SVG's width, in pixels
getDimensionDataWidth :: MonadIO m => DimensionData -> m Int32 Source #
Get the value of the “width” field.
When overloading is enabled, this is equivalent to
get dimensionData #width
setDimensionDataWidth :: MonadIO m => DimensionData -> Int32 -> m () Source #
Set the value of the “width” field.
When overloading is enabled, this is equivalent to
setdimensionData [ #width:=value ]
